Helping Depressed Loved Ones

Depression is a psychological problem affecting almost all people at some stage of their lives. Depression obstructs the normal functioning of a person at work, in society, and in family relationships. Studies show that more than 17 million Americans experience a period of clinical depression every year. A person who experiences serious depression might destroy his own life or that of his whole family. So it is vital to help your depressed loved ones.


Clinical Depression in Men

Studies have shown that, although there are more women who get treated for clinical depression, there are actually about the same number of men who suffer the condition, but they do not admit it or seek treatment for it. Society often mistakenly labels men who get clinically depressed as ?weaklings.? This causes men to hide their conditions rather than come forward and seek medical attention.

Depressive Illness

The word depression is used to describe both a symptom and an illness. The symptom is the experience of gloom, despondency, sadness, grief; the feeling of being run down, dispirited, miserable, melancholic, in the dumps, or being low.
